Long term its bad for your health. Its actually illegal in Canada. Cops pulled people over and they were "high" but the breathalyzer couldn't catch it. They eventually caught on. For those who don't know its a root that you grind into powder then mix with water and drink. Here is a pic of a tanoa which gives you an idea of what it looks like. It just looks like muddy water. http://images.travelpod.com/users/bg...-the-tanoa.jpg |
